The importance of Matty C Dan Leberfeld

Jets added an important piece to their coaching puzzle on August 25.

They hired Matt Cavanaugh as a senior offensive assistant.

The long-time NFL assistant will help Jets offensive coordinator Mike LaFleur and QB coach Rob Calabrese.

“To have that old soul who’s had so many different experiences, for Mike as a play caller, to help him through all the different questions he might have, game planning, such a valuable resource,” said Jets coach Robert Saleh.

And Cavanaugh will also be a huge help to Calabrese, a first-time NFL QB coach, who was brought in to assist Greg Knapp with the quarterbacks, but Knapp was killed by a motorist, texting and driving, while riding his bike in California, right before training camp.

“Obviously, for the quarterback and talking about the different experiences that he’s had, and developing quarterbacks along the way, [Cavanaugh’s role is] very similar, God rest his soul, with Knapper (Greg Knapp) and what we were expecting out of him,” Saleh said. “To have [Cavanaugh], he’s going to provide a lot.”
